static unsigned int
|
|
blz_getbit(struct blz_state *bs)
|
|
{
|
|
unsigned int bit;
|
|
|
|
/* Check if tag is empty */
|
|
if (!bs->bits_left--) {
|
|
/* Load next tag */
|
|
bs->tag = (unsigned int) bs->src[0]
|
|
| ((unsigned int) bs->src[1] << 8);
|
|
bs->src += 2;
|
|
bs->bits_left = 15;
|
|
}
|
|
|
|
/* Shift bit out of tag */
|
|
bit = (bs->tag & 0x8000) ? 1 : 0;
|
|
bs->tag <<= 1;
|
|
|
|
return bit;
|
|
}
|
|
|
|
static unsigned long
|
|
blz_getgamma(struct blz_state *bs)
|
|
{
|
|
unsigned long result = 1;
|
|
|
|
#if !defined(BLZ_NO_LUT)
|
|
/* Decode up to 8 bits of gamma2 code using lookup if possible */
|
|
if (bs->bits_left >= 8) {
|
|
unsigned int top8 = (bs->tag >> 8) & 0x00FF;
|
|
int shift;
|
|
|
|
result = blz_gamma_lookup[top8][0];
|
|
shift = (int) blz_gamma_lookup[top8][1];
|
|
|
|
if (shift) {
|
|
bs->tag <<= shift;
|
|
bs->bits_left -= shift;
|
|
return result;
|
|
}
|
|
|
|
bs->tag <<= 8;
|
|
bs->bits_left -= 8;
|
|
}
|
|
#endif
|
|
|
|
/* Input gamma2-encoded bits */
|
|
do {
|
|
result = (result << 1) + blz_getbit(bs);
|
|
} while (blz_getbit(bs));
|
|
|
|
return result;
|
|
}
|
|
|
|
unsigned long
|
|
blz_depack(const void *src, void *dst, unsigned long depacked_size)
|
|
{
|
|
struct blz_state bs;
|
|
unsigned long dst_size = 0;
|
|
|
|
bs.src = (const unsigned char *) src;
|
|
bs.dst = (unsigned char *) dst;
|
|
|
|
/* Initialise to one bit left in tag; that bit is zero (a literal) */
|
|
bs.bits_left = 1;
|
|
bs.tag = 0x4000;
|
|
|
|
/* Main decompression loop */
|
|
while (dst_size < depacked_size) {
|
|
if (blz_getbit(&bs)) {
|
|
/* Input match length and offset */
|
|
unsigned long len = blz_getgamma(&bs) + 2;
|
|
unsigned long off = blz_getgamma(&bs) - 2;
|
|
|
|
off = (off << 8) + (unsigned long) *bs.src++ + 1;
|
|
|
|
/* Copy match */
|
|
{
|
|
const unsigned char *p = bs.dst - off;
|
|
unsigned long i;
|
|
|
|
for (i = len; i > 0; --i) {
|
|
*bs.dst++ = *p++;
|
|
}
|
|
}
|
|
|
|
dst_size += len;
|
|
}
|
|
else {
|
|
/* Copy literal */
|
|
*bs.dst++ = *bs.src++;
|
|
|
|
dst_size++;
|
|
}
|
|
}
|
|
|
|
/* Return decompressed size */
|
|
return dst_size;
|
|
}
